Package: chromium
Version: 126.0.6478.126-1~deb13u1
Severity: normal

Hi there!

When i use chromium to watch a video, using sway and wayland (no X11 or
XWayland on this system), i get very noisy messages to stderr,
apparently about one message per frame of video.

I typically use set --ozone-platform-hint=auto, or set it explicitly in
chrome://flags/#ozone-platform-hint (See
https://bugs.debian,org/1075982, where i explain why i think this should
be the default).

In this configuration, playing any video produces a very noisy stream of
messages to stderr.  

In particular, i see a line like this appear roughly once per frame:

```
[635461:635515:0728/122929.891862:ERROR:gbm_pixmap_wayland.cc(82)] Cannot 
create bo with format= YUV_420_BIPLANAR and usage=SCANOUT_CPU_READ_WRITE
```

Note that the video plays perfectly!  The only complaint here is about
the noisy stderr, which makes it impossible to catch any real warnings
that might also show up on stderr.

This happens with any video, but i've confirmed it (so that it's easy to
reproduce) with a video from debconf23:

```
chromium 
'https://gemmei.ftp.acc.umu.se/pub/debian-meetings/2023/DebConf23/debconf23-306-face-to-face-debian-meetings-in-a-climate-crisis.av1.webm
```

According to ffprobe, that video is 25 fps.  If i run the above command,
capturing stderr, and a kill it after 100 seconds, the resulting file
contains 2478 error messages like above, though the numbers in the
prefix differ slightly.  I assume that's 1 message per frame of video,
with a little bit of wiggle room in the timing for startup and network
fetch.

Please let me know if there are more detailed tests i can do, or patches
i could try, that would help to debug this situation more effectively.

Regards,

        --dkg


-- System Information:
Debian Release: trixie/sid
  APT prefers testing-debug
  APT policy: (500, 'testing-debug'), (500, 'testing'), (200, 
'unstable-debug'), (200, 'unstable')
Architecture: amd64 (x86_64)

Kernel: Linux 6.9.9-amd64 (SMP w/20 CPU threads; PREEMPT)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8), LANGUAGE not set
Shell: /bin/sh linked to /usr/b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led

Versions of packages chromium depends on:
ii  chromium-common        126.0.6478.126-1~deb13u1
ii  libasound2t64          1.2.12-1
ii  libatk-bridge2.0-0t64  2.52.0-1
ii  libatk1.0-0t64         2.52.0-1
ii  libatomic1             14-20240330-1
ii  libatspi2.0-0t64       2.52.0-1
ii  libc6                  2.39-4
ii  libcairo2              1.18.0-3+b1
ii  libcups2t64            2.4.10-1
ii  libdav1d7              1.4.3-1
ii  libdbus-1-3            1.14.10-4+b1
ii  libdouble-conversion3  3.3.0-1+b1
ii  libdrm2                2.4.121-2
ii  libevent-2.1-7t64      2.1.12-stable-10
ii  libexpat1              2.6.2-1
ii  libflac12t64           1.4.3+ds-2.1
ii  libfontconfig1         2.15.0-1.1
ii  libfreetype6           2.13.2+dfsg-1+b4
ii  libgbm1                24.1.3-2
ii  libgcc-s1              14-20240330-1
ii  libglib2.0-0t64        2.80.4-1
ii  libgtk-3-0t64          3.24.43-1
ii  libharfbuzz-subset0    8.3.0-2+b1
ii  libharfbuzz0b          8.3.0-2+b1
ii  libjpeg62-turbo        1:2.1.5-3
ii  libjsoncpp25           1.9.5-6+b2
ii  liblcms2-2             2.14-2+b1
ii  libminizip1t64         1:1.3.dfsg+really1.3.1-1
ii  libnspr4               2:4.35-1.1+b1
ii  libnss3                2:3.102-1
ii  libopenh264-7          2.4.1+dfsg-1
ii  libopenjp2-7           2.5.0-2+b3
ii  libopus0               1.5.2-2
ii  libpango-1.0-0         1.54.0+ds-1
ii  libpng16-16t64         1.6.43-5
ii  libpulse0              16.1+dfsg1-5.1
ii  libsnappy1v5           1.2.1-1
ii  libstdc++6             14-20240330-1
ii  libwoff1               1.0.2-2+b1
ii  libx11-6               2:1.8.7-1+b1
ii  libxcb1                1.17.0-2
ii  libxcomposite1         1:0.4.5-1+b1
ii  libxdamage1            1:1.1.6-1+b1
ii  libxext6               2:1.3.4-1+b1
ii  libxfixes3             1:6.0.0-2+b1
ii  libxkbcommon0          1.6.0-1+b1
ii  libxml2                2.9.14+dfsg-1.3+b3
ii  libxnvctrl0            535.171.04-1
ii  libxrandr2             2:1.5.4-1
ii  libxslt1.1             1.1.35-1.1
ii  zlib1g                 1:1.3.dfsg+really1.3.1-1

Versions of packages chromium recommends:
ii  chromium-sandbox  126.0.6478.126-1~deb13u1

Versions of packages chromium suggests:
pn  chromium-driver  <none>
pn  chromium-l10n    <none>
pn  chromium-shell   <none>

Versions of packages chromium-common depends on:
ii  libc6         2.39-4
ii  libdrm2       2.4.121-2
ii  libgcc-s1     14-20240330-1
ii  libjsoncpp25  1.9.5-6+b2
ii  libstdc++6    14-20240330-1
ii  libx11-6      2:1.8.7-1+b1
ii  libxnvctrl0   535.171.04-1
ii  x11-utils     7.7+6+b1
ii  xdg-utils     1.1.3-4.1
ii  zlib1g        1:1.3.dfsg+really1.3.1-1

Versions of packages chromium-common recommends:
ii  chromium-sandbox             126.0.6478.126-1~deb13u1
ii  dunst [notification-daemon]  1.11.0-1
ii  fonts-liberation             1:2.1.5-3
ii  libgl1-mesa-dri              24.1.3-2
ii  notification-daemon          3.20.0-4+b2
pn  system-config-printer        <none>
ii  udev                         256.2-1
ii  upower                       1.90.3-1+b1

Versions of packages chromium-sandbox depends on:
ii  libc6  2.39-4

-- no debconf information

Attachment: signature.asc
Description: PGP signature

Reply via email to